Grasping Guindaste Capacities From Construction to Industry

When evaluating the effectiveness of a guindaste for your project, understanding its lifting capacity is paramount. Guindaste capacities are expressed in units like metric tons or pounds and reflect the maximum weight the equipment can safely elevate.

In infrastructure projects, guindaste capacities are vital for moving heavy structures, guaranteeing the efficiency of operations. Correspondingly, in industrial settings, guindaste capacities play a crucial role in transporting large machinery and goods.
